    12. Can I output via Mini DisplayPort to an RCA or S-Video connection?
    No. The Mini DIsplayPort connector allows output to Mini DisplayPort, DisplayPort, VGA, DVI, and HDMI connections when using the proper cables and adapters. However, output to RCA, Component, or S-Video connections is not supported.

  • Macbook, Mini DVI to Composite/S-Video and Vizio 32" LCD.  HELP: Resolution

    So I bought this adapter to hook-up my LCD TV to the Macbook, and I cannot get the correct resolution for this TV.
    "32" HD 1366 x 768 native LCD HDTV" is the Specs.
    NOW, I did download SwitchResX, but was unsuccessful in registering the custom 1366 x 768 resolution, the LCD TV simply prompts: "No Signal"
    Under 1280x768 the TV does work, but it looks blurry.
    Please Help

    The Mini DVI to Composite/S-Video is for use at standard TV resolutions, such as 640 x 480. Fo the full 1366 x 768 try using a DVI to HDMI cable with the Mini-DVI to DVI adapter

  • Video (or Video + Audio) Data Rate

    Wondered if anyone here might know of a software utility that has the ability to scan QuickTime compatible files and either display the video (or video + audio) data rate excursion or, as an alternative, graph the instantaneous variation in the data rate over time.

    Apple +I (show info) in QT player will show you the framerate and bitrate while playing.
    Thanks for your suggestion, Rick. However, I must point out that the data rate so displayed is simply the total average for the entire clip and not the instantaneous (i.e., constantly changing) variance with time. Preliminary observations tend to indicate the single pass H.264 algorithm begings roughly 10% under the requested data rate and quickly settles very near the target. The multipass algorithm, on the other hand, appears to begin in the vicinity of 300% above the targeed data rate and monotonically decreases throughout the remainder of the movie clip. So much for a quick qualitative analysis based on observations during the actualy encoding process.
    What I now wish to do is actually perform a bit of quantitative analysis and, based on those results, correlate actual data rates with the ability of a given H.264 multipass file to sync to an iPod. Basically, I am trying to determine whether or not a user data rate input is used as a comparator during the initial phase of multipass H.264 coding and, if so, how it is implemented. (I.e., how are the delta values handled -- linearly, exponentially, etc.) In addition, I wish to compare QT v7.0.3 with v7.0.4 clips to determine why the latter are less iPod compatible. Too, there remains a question as to whether or not any data rate information is now embedded in the clips themselves since various work arounds tried (i.e., clipping file lengths) have proven unsuccessful.
